Under general supervision the Mental Health Response Coordinator responds to crisis referrals providing timely interventions assessing risk and connecting individuals to appropriate care. Collaboration with campus departments and external community partners is essential along with maintaining confidential records and adhering to HIPAA guidelines.

  • Responds to referrals from campus community (administrators faculty staff) regarding individuals in distress.
  • Provides crisis intervention in various locations on- and off-campus that is both culturally responsive and utilizes trauma-informed practices.
  • Assesses the nature of the crisis safety concerns and level of risk.
  • Supports individuals in accessing and connecting to resources and the appropriate level of care.
  • Maintains highly confidential files following current campus CSU state and federal guidelines.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• NOTE : To view the full position description including all of the required qualifications copy and paste this link into your browser : to graduation from a four-year college or university in a related field. Upper division or graduate course work in counseling techniques interviewing and conflict resolution where such are job-related is preferred.
  • Equivalent to four years of progressively responsible professional student services work experience which includes experience in advising students individually and in groups and in analysis and resolution of complex student services problems.
  • A Masters degree in Counseling Clinical Psychology Social Work or a job-related field may be substituted for one year of professional experience.

Knowledge Skills & Abilities

  • Demonstrated knowledge of crisis intervention strategies trauma-informed care practices and mental health case management.
  • Ability to assess crisis situations accurately recognizing safety concerns risk levels and appropriate response measures. Ability to effectively collaborate and coordinate with multidisciplinary teams including campus community partners and emergency response personnel.
  • Skilled in facilitating connections for individuals in crisis to essential resources and care ensuring community safety and well-being.
  • Proficiency in maintaining confidential records in compliance with campus CSU state and federal guidelines particularly HIPAA.
  • Pay Benefits & Work Schedule

  • The university offers an excellent benefits package including but not limited to : medical dental vision retirement & savings tuition waiver and more.
  • Classification : 3086 / SSP IV / Grade 1
  • The anticipated HIRING RANGE : $ 6320- $ 6615 per month dependent upon qualifications and experience. The salary range for this classification is : $ 6320 - $ 9014 per month.
  • HOURS : Full Time; 40 hours per week; Monday through Friday; working hours : 11am - 8 pm.
  • This is a Regular position with a one-year probationary period.
